Best Affordable Neighborhoods in Miami, FL
Some of the cheapest neighborhoods in Miami are South Miami Heights, Cloverleaf Estates, and Liberty City. These neighborhoods offer some of the lowest rent prices in Miami, making them ideal for renters on a budget. As of May 25, 2026, the average rent in Miami is $2,236, which is 0.4% higher than last year. However, it's important to remember that rental prices can vary significantly based on factors such as location, amenities, and floor plans.
South Miami Heights
Average Rent
$1,410/Month
Year-Over-Year Rent Change
1.2%
Units Available
47 Rentals
When you’re looking for a great Miami neighborhood on a budget, check out South Miami Heights. The average rent is $1,410, compared to the city average of $2,236. Rent prices have increased by 1.2%. South Miami Heights is convenient to Bill Sadowski Park, Miami International, and Quail Roost Plaza.

Methodology
Transit Score measures access to public transit. Scores range from 0 (minimal transit) to 100 (rider’s paradise). Learn more about the Transit Score methodology. Rental data is sourced from CoStar Group’s Market Trend reports. As a leading authority in commercial real estate information, analytics, and news, CoStar performs in-depth research to build and sustain an extensive database of commercial real estate insights.
We've combined this data with public records to provide the most current rental information available.
